How Does Exosome Therapy Work?

Exosome therapy harnesses the power of exosomes, small extracellular vesicles secreted by cells, to facilitate communication between cells and modulate various biological processes. These vesicles carry proteins, nucleic acids, and other bioactive molecules, exerting profound effects on recipient cells. By targeting specific cells and tissues, the role of exosome therapy promotes tissue regeneration, reduces inflammation, and supports healing processes, making it a promising approach for cosmetic treatments.

Can Exosome Therapy Be Combined With Other Rejuvenation Treatments?

With its versatility and wide-ranging potential applications, exosome therapy presents an exciting opportunity to enhance outcomes when combined with treatments like Skin Pen microneedling and Hair Rejuvenation protocols. While only approved on-label for use topically, there are off label applications for exosomes Dr. Culver can discuss with individual patients to decide if they are good candidates. Dr Culver’s non-surgical approaches to cosmetic rejuvenation see the combination of these potential applications for maximized results.

When combined with SkinPen microneedling, exosomes serve as potent therapeutic agents, enhancing the rejuvenating effects. As microneedles create micro-injuries, exosomes penetrate the skin barrier, delivering bioactive molecules to target cells like fibroblasts. This interaction triggers tissue growth, facilitates repair processes, and fosters intercellular communication, resulting in improved skin texture and tone.

In hair rejuvenation, exosomes play a pivotal role in promoting follicular health and stimulating hair growth. Administered directly to the scalp, exosomes interact with endothelial cells, fostering tissue repair and regeneration. Their cargo of genetic material and bioactive molecules facilitates intercellular communication, rejuvenating the hair follicles and addressing underlying factors contributing to hair loss.

How often should I undergo exosome therapy or microneedling to maintain optimal results?

The recommended frequency for exosome therapy or microneedling depends on your specific skin condition and the results you wish to achieve. Generally, we advise a series of treatments spaced 4-6 weeks apart, followed by periodic maintenance sessions. What are exosomes, and how do they work in the body?

Exosomes are small extracellular vesicles released by cells, playing a crucial role in intercellular communication. Originating from multivesicular bodies, they contain a wide range of biomolecules, including proteins and nucleic acids. Upon release, exosomes interact with recipient cells, influencing various physiological processes and contributing to tissue repair and homeostasis.

What is the relationship between exosomes and tissue damage?

In response to tissue damage or injury, clinical applications have shown cells play an essential role when they release exosomes containing factors that promote tissue repair and regeneration. These exosomes facilitate cell-to-cell communication, orchestrating the repair process and minimizing the extent of damage. By delivering a range of biomolecules, exosomes support the restoration of tissue integrity and function following injury. The same process is what makes them ideal for cosmetic therapeutic applications for the skin.
